I can only speak to the Treks, but I just went through this same FX v Dual Sport conundrum. I believe stock FX 2’s come with 700x35c and their max tire size (per Trek) is 38 without fenders so there is a pretty quick ceiling to where you can go. One person - out of many I spoke to - told me maybe 40 would fit, but seems it could be tight on the back. Dual sport 2 gen 4 comes with 700x40c and gen 5 comes with 650x50c. I don’t know anything about the Cannondale you’re looking at, I only briefly considered a cx3. The dual gen 5’s don’t have the front suspension fork anymore and sub in the 650x50 tires, but their price point is a bit higher than the 4’s. I personally opted for the FX 2 as Trekfest is on until end of the month so there was a discount, and I’ll mainly cycle paved roads. But if I suspected I’d be on more gravel or bumpy terrain, I probably would have gone dual sport. The position on the two is slightly different with the dual a bit more upright. Get on both, if you can, and see what feels best to you. If you have any more questions about the Treks, feel free to shoot me a message. Good luck!
